On Saturday, we took the day off / out. We've been holed up too long at home working on accounts, web sites, and all the other stuff that comes with our business so that - although we are not short of things to do - we needed a refresh.
I have often driven through Pewsey ... but never stopped. So on Saturday we stopped - and what a pleasant little town it is. The architecture of this building, on the curve of the road, was very interesting. More pictures of Pewsey here
